Cosè il sé in Python: esempi del mondo reale
Cos'è il sé in Python: esempi del mondo reale
Nel tutorial di oggi, voglio sottolineare quanto sia importante costruire correttamente le relazioni del modello di dati.
La modellazione dei dati è una delle basi del tuo report LuckyTemplates, quindi è necessario configurarla correttamente.
In precedenza, ho discusso alcune tecniche che possono aiutarti a gestire correttamente il tuo modello. Uno di questi riguarda la creazione delle relazioni di tutte le tabelle esistenti all'interno di LuckyTemplates.
In questo tutorial, voglio insegnarti come impostare correttamente le tue connessioni dati. Innanzitutto, assicurati di aver già ottimizzato le tue tabelle. Se vuoi controllare più tecniche nella gestione delle tue tabelle, puoi andare qui .
Sommario
Creazione di relazioni del modello di dati uno-a-molti
Assicurati di posizionare le tabelle di ricerca in alto e la tabella dei fatti in basso. Questo è il modo in cui dovresti sempre iniziare le tue relazioni con il modello di dati . Puoi facilmente creare la relazione trascinando e rilasciando qualsiasi colonna da una tabella all'altra.
Nell'esempio, puoi vedere che la tabella di ricerca Clienti è connessa alla tabella Fatti vendite . Se guardi più da vicino, noterai che la freccia proviene dalla tabella Clienti e scende alla tabella Vendite .
Questo è un esempio di relazione uno-a-molti. In questa relazione del modello di dati, si fa riferimento ai dati del cliente dalla tabella Clienti solo una volta. Nel frattempo, i dati del cliente dalla tabella Sales vengono referenziati molte volte.
Ecco perché sono i molti lati che sono rappresentati da una stella. La freccia indica anche la direzione in cui scorrerà il filtro.
È inoltre possibile collegare la colonna Data della tabella Date alla colonna Data ordine della tabella Vendite per creare un'altra relazione uno-a-molti.
Questa volta, puoi portare la colonna Index dalla tabella Products alla colonna Product Description Index della tabella Sales .
Inoltre, puoi collegare la colonna Indice dalla tabella Regioni alla colonna Indice regione di consegna della tabella Vendite .
Questo è il modo in cui dovresti impostare correttamente il tuo modello di dati. Quando segui questa tecnica, puoi costruire in modo efficiente il tuo modello di dati e creare un ottimo report LuckyTemplates in un secondo momento. Non preoccuparti troppo di renderlo perfetto, assicurati solo di fare le cose in modo efficiente.
Infine, puoi creare un'altra relazione uno-a-molti trascinando la colonna Canale dalla tabella Canali alla colonna Canale della tabella Vendite .
Impostazione delle relazioni del modello di dati molti-a-uno
Ora che hai imparato a conoscere il tipo di relazioni uno-a-molti, ti insegnerò anche la relazione molti-a-uno.
Per gestire le relazioni dati esistenti, puoi fare doppio clic su una delle righe. Un altro modo è fare clic su Gestisci relazioni .
Nella finestra Modifica relazione , puoi vedere le tabelle e le colonne collegate. Ad esempio, è possibile visualizzare l' indice dei nomi dei clienti della tabella delle vendite e la colonna dell'indice dei clienti della tabella dei clienti . Nella sezione Cardinalità , puoi vedere che ha una relazione dati molti-a-uno.
Questo tipo di relazione del modello di dati è chiaramente diverso dal primo che ho discusso in precedenza. La relazione dati molti-a-uno consente a qualsiasi filtro di andare in entrambe le direzioni.
Nella sezione Direzione filtro incrociato , puoi selezionare Single o Both . In questo caso, devi selezionare Singolo perché la selezione di un doppio filtro può creare molta confusione.
L'utilizzo di relazioni di dati uno-a-molti ti impedirà di ottenere risultati strani nel tuo rapporto. Se vuoi semplificare il tuo modello di dati, puoi continuare a utilizzare la relazione uno-a-molti.
Le 3 migliori pratiche per organizzare i modelli LuckyTemplates
Creazione di relazioni virtuali in LuckyTemplates Utilizzo della funzione TREATAS
Come lavorare con più date in LuckyTemplates
Conclusione
Indipendentemente dalle informazioni aziendali con cui hai a che fare, assicurati di seguire la struttura del modello di dati di base.
Spero che tu abbia imparato qualcosa di nuovo sulla modellazione dei dati. Ho menzionato i due tipi di relazioni del modello di dati: uno-a-molti e molti-a-uno.
Tuttavia, esistono ancora altri tipi di relazioni di dati che è possibile incontrare. Ad esempio, uno a uno e molti a molti. Ma non preoccuparti, devi solo capire questi per ora.
Spero che la modellazione dei dati abbia più senso dopo questo tutorial. Se vuoi ottenere maggiori informazioni e scenari simili per il tuo modello di dati, dai un'occhiata al .
Grazie!
Cos'è il sé in Python: esempi del mondo reale
Imparerai come salvare e caricare oggetti da un file .rds in R. Questo blog tratterà anche come importare oggetti da R a LuckyTemplates.
In questa esercitazione sul linguaggio di codifica DAX, scopri come usare la funzione GENERATE e come modificare dinamicamente il titolo di una misura.
Questo tutorial illustrerà come utilizzare la tecnica di visualizzazione dinamica multi-thread per creare approfondimenti dalle visualizzazioni di dati dinamici nei report.
In questo articolo, esaminerò il contesto del filtro. Il contesto del filtro è uno degli argomenti principali che qualsiasi utente di LuckyTemplates dovrebbe inizialmente conoscere.
Voglio mostrare come il servizio online di LuckyTemplates Apps può aiutare nella gestione di diversi report e approfondimenti generati da varie fonti.
Scopri come elaborare le modifiche al margine di profitto utilizzando tecniche come la ramificazione delle misure e la combinazione di formule DAX in LuckyTemplates.
Questo tutorial discuterà delle idee di materializzazione delle cache di dati e di come influiscono sulle prestazioni dei DAX nel fornire risultati.
Se finora utilizzi ancora Excel, questo è il momento migliore per iniziare a utilizzare LuckyTemplates per le tue esigenze di reportistica aziendale.
Che cos'è il gateway LuckyTemplates? Tutto quello che devi sapere